Well, Clickbank has some nice features, and I've found it easy to use.

On the other hand, their site is a bit slow at times, which means it will be slow when a customer tries to buy something from you.

Also, if the customer tries to return to your site from the shopping cart page, Clickbank will put your site into a frame, with their information in a frame at the top of the page.

I have been using ClickBank for a couple of month and received a check from them. I have been trying to cash it in for a month now but I guess there is no problem if you're located in US.

Their members interface is really amateurish and you can for example not see your sales in more than a 2 weeks span. And I believe that you can only see your commission for max two payouts periods(one period =15 days). I mean there is no total commission earnings.
